I’ve just noticed a small black mark on one of my teeth. The tooth already has a filling in it. I’ve tried to feel if there is a hole - my tongue is telling me yes to that! There is no pain or tenderness so it isn’t a dental emergency, but obviously, I don’t want it to get worse.

I don’t really know what I should be doing with it! Any advice?

Keep it clean. Use fluoride toothpaste and a non alcohol fluoride rinse
Try to have less sweet sticky fizzy foods and drinks
If it becomes uncomfortable you might get phone advice from your dentist
Ours are doing a phone triage/ advice service
